About this vintage design furniture

A beautiful pair of lounge chairs designed by Theo Ruth and manufactured by Artifort in the Netherlands circa 1950.The smooth, curved shape of the seats, the attention to detail, and the playful yet elegant style make this a very recognizable design by Theo Ruth. The legs of the chairs are made of high quality beech wood, warm brown in color, slightly tapered. One chair has slightly lighter legs than the other. The seats are covered in a beautiful yellow square patterned fabric that has been left in exceptional condition. The deep, thick seat and ergonomic shapes create a very comfortable seating experience, making this set an interior favorite. Sold individually. Price is per chair. Please check the latest stock information above.Each chair is in very good original condition, with minor wear consistent with age and use, preserving a beautiful patina.

About the designer

Théo RUTH

Theo Ruth is a talented Dutch designer. He was the first designer for the renowned Artifort, and is known for having played a major role in the brand's worldwide success.
